Starmind Announces CEO Transition
Starmind is grateful for Oliver's leadership in scaling the company globally, doubling headcount in the last two years and building a deep bench of exceptional leaders who will drive Starmind's vision, strategy and growth plans forward to…
Read More...
Read More...